IP Country City ISP
146.70.133.131 United Kingdom Yorkshire Electricity
146.70.186.156 United Kingdom Yorkshire Electricity
146.70.204.163 United Kingdom Yorkshire Electricity
147.147.155.23 United Kingdom London Plusnet
185.92.26.70 United Kingdom Total Server Solutions L.L.C.
194.33.45.67 United Kingdom Hello.uk.net
77.68.41.119 United Kingdom Gloucester 1&1 Internet AG
86.134.159.193 United Kingdom St Ives BT
88.208.218.105 United Kingdom Preston 1&1 Internet AG
88.208.245.167 United Kingdom Gloucester 1&1 Internet AG